在现代化的制造业中,数控(Numerical Control)技术已经成为了提高加工效率、保证加工质量的重要手段。其中,圆柱加工是数控编程中非常基础且应用广泛的一项技术。今天,我们就来探讨如何掌握数控编程技巧,轻松操控圆柱加工。
数控加工与圆柱加工概述
数控加工
数控加工是指通过数控编程,利用数控机床进行自动加工的一种技术。数控机床包括数控车床、数控铣床、数控磨床等,它们通过CNC(Computer Numerical Control)系统接收程序指令,完成零件的加工。
圆柱加工
圆柱加工是指加工圆柱形零件的过程,它包括车削、镗削、铣削等多种方式。在数控加工中,圆柱加工通常是通过数控车床或数控铣床完成的。
数控编程技巧
1. 了解机床和刀具
在开始编程之前,首先需要了解所使用的机床和刀具的性能、参数以及加工特点。这有助于我们选择合适的加工参数,如切削速度、进给量等。
2. 选择合适的编程语言
目前,常见的数控编程语言有G代码和M代码。G代码主要用于控制机床的运动和加工过程,而M代码主要用于控制机床的辅助动作。在实际编程过程中,根据加工需求选择合适的编程语言至关重要。
3. 编写加工路径
编写加工路径是数控编程的核心。在编写加工路径时,需要注意以下几点:
- 起点与终点:加工路径的起点和终点应选择在便于装夹和测量位置。
- 加工顺序:遵循先粗后精、先外后内的原则,确保加工精度和效率。
- 切削参数:根据零件材料、刀具和机床性能,合理设置切削速度、进给量等参数。
4. 添加辅助指令
在编程过程中,为了提高加工效率和保证加工质量,需要添加一些辅助指令,如刀具补偿、循环指令等。
圆柱加工实例
以下是一个简单的圆柱加工编程实例:
O1000 ; 程序号
G21 ; 使用毫米单位
G90 ; 绝对编程模式
G0 X100 Y100 ; 快速定位到指定位置
G0 Z1 ; 快速定位到Z轴起始位置
G43 H1 ; 开启刀具补偿
G94 F200 ; 设置进给速度为200mm/min
G96 S600 ; 设置恒定切削速度为600m/min
G0 Z-1 ; 快速定位到加工深度
G1 Z-2 F100 ; 直线切削,进给速度为100mm/min
G0 Z1 ; 快速定位到Z轴起始位置
G40 ; 关闭刀具补偿
G0 X100 Y100 ; 快速定位到起始位置
M30 ; 程序结束
在这个例子中,我们首先使用G21设置单位为毫米,然后使用G90进入绝对编程模式。接下来,使用G0指令快速定位到指定位置,并开启刀具补偿。然后,设置切削速度和进给速度,并开始加工。最后,关闭刀具补偿,快速定位回起始位置,并结束程序。
总结
掌握数控编程技巧,对于操控圆柱加工具有重要意义。通过了解机床和刀具、选择合适的编程语言、编写加工路径以及添加辅助指令,我们可以轻松地进行圆柱加工。希望本文能对您有所帮助。
